Understanding Testosterone’s Role in Muscle Function

Muscle tissue is highly responsive to testosterone levels. This hormone supports protein synthesis and increases the number of neurotransmitters involved in muscle activation. When testosterone decreases, these biological processes slow down, making muscle growth and maintenance more difficult. By restoring hormonal balance, testosterone therapy promotes the body’s ability to build lean muscle while also enhancing endurance. The impact is often more noticeable in individuals who combine therapy with a strength-focused exercise regimen and a balanced diet. Clinical Benefits of Muscle Development through TRT

Men undergoing testosterone therapy often report improved strength, enhanced muscle tone, and increased exercise capacity. Clinical studies have shown that testosterone contributes to higher nitrogen retention in muscle tissue, which helps with both hypertrophy and repair. These effects are particularly beneficial for aging adults seeking to counteract muscle wasting or sarcopenia. This therapeutic option also helps reduce body fat, indirectly benefiting muscle visibility and definition. The dual effect of muscle development and fat reduction often leads to improved body composition. Testosterone therapy is not just about aesthetics; it supports metabolic efficiency and joint stability, which is essential for injury prevention and overall mobility.
